Slate roof in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a slate roofing system to assess its condition and identify potential issues. Skilled service providers examine the roof’s surface, checking for cracked, broken, or missing slate tiles, as well as signs of wear or deterioration. They also inspect the underlying structure, flashing, and joints to ensure everything is functioning correctly. This process helps homeowners understand the current state of their roof, pinpoint areas that may need repairs, and determine whether the roof is still providing effective protection against the elements.
Identifying problems early can prevent more extensive damage and costly repairs down the line. Common issues that slate roof inspections uncover include cracked or broken tiles that can allow water infiltration, loose or missing pieces, and signs of aging such as moss or algae growth. Inspections can also reveal underlying problems like rotting sheathing or compromised flashing that could lead to leaks or structural damage if left unaddressed. Regular inspections are especially valuable for maintaining the longevity of a slate roof and avoiding unexpected repairs.
Slate roofs are often found on historic or high-end residential properties, such as older homes, estate houses, and luxury condominiums. These roofs are valued for their durability, distinctive appearance, and long lifespan, making them a popular choice for properties where preservation and aesthetic appeal are priorities. Commercial buildings, churches, and public facilities with traditional or historic architecture may also utilize slate roofing. The overview below groups typical Slate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Twinsburg,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ine inspections and minor repairs for slate roofs in the Twinsburg area typically range from $250 to $600. These projects often involve checking for broken or loose slates and minor patchwork. Most common j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er reaching the higher end.
Moderate Projects - Larger repairs or partial restorations usually cost between $600 and $2,000 for local contractors. These may include replacing multiple slates or addressing more extensive damage caused by weather or age. Such projects are less frequent but represent a significant portion of work in the region.
Full Roof Inspection - Comprehensive inspections to assess the entire slate roof generally fall in the $200-$500 range. Many homeowners opt for this service to identify potential issues early, with most inspections landing in this lower to mid-range band.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ete slate roof replacements in the Twinsburg area can cost from $10,000 to $30,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more intricate roofs tend to push costs into the higher tiers, though many replacements remain within the lower to mid-range estimates for standard homes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ating contractors for slate roof inspection services in the Twinsburg, OH area,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how long a service provider has been performing inspections specifically for slate roofs, as this material requires specialized knowledge to assess properly. An experienced contractor will understand the unique characteristics of slate, such as its weight, installation methods, and common issues, which can lead to a more thorough and accurate evaluation of the roof’s condition.

What is involved in a slate roof inspection? A professional inspection typically includes examining the slate tiles for damage, checking for loose or missing pieces, and assessing the overall condition of the roof structure to identify potential issues.
Why should I have my slate roof inspected regularly? Regular inspections help detect early signs of wear, damage, or deterioration, which can prevent costly repairs and extend the lifespan of the roof.
How can a slate roof inspection benefit my property? An inspection can identify existing problems before they worsen, ensuring the roof remains functional and maintaining the property's value.
What signs indicate my slate roof might need an inspection? Visible cracked or broken tiles, moss or algae growth, or signs of leaks inside the building are indicators that a professional inspection may be necessary.
How do local contractors perform slate roof inspections? Local service providers typically conduct thorough visual assessments, sometimes using specialized tools to evaluate the roof's condition and identify issues that may not be immediately visible.
